Ticket: Staging env misconfigured for Siftgate bloom filter

The bloom layer in front of the Pellet KV store is rejecting all lookups in staging because the env file was copied from the dev template without credentials. False-positive tuning values are fine; only the auth line is missing. To unblock the weekly demo, the Pellet admission secret must be set on the following line.

env line for yaguf-fajop: LEDGER_TOKEN13=fb08984397349

Adds the retention sweeper for Mossfen archives. Support note: closed tickets older than the retention window are now purged nightly; customers asking for deleted attachments should be pointed at the export tool before the cutoff. Sweeper runs in batches with a hard rate cap so it won't slow live traffic. Dry-run mode is on for the first week. Current sweep parameters are as follows.

tuning table, kajog-bawip:
TIERS = {
    "kelius": 256,
    "lammir": 543,
}

## Idempotency Keys for Payment Retries (Lumopay)

Every retry of a charge request must reuse the original idempotency key; generating a new key on retry can produce duplicate charges. Keys are scoped per merchant and expire after 48 hours. Reviewers should verify keys are derived server-side, never from client input. The full key-generation specification and threat model are maintained on the internal page.

dashboard of kaguf-tawip = https://vault.merlaqsys.test/issue